简体中文简体中文
EnglishEnglish
简体中文简体中文

在线学习中的源码探索:解锁编程世界的秘密钥匙

2025-01-20 16:10:11

随着互联网技术的飞速发展,在线学习平台如雨后春笋般涌现,为广大学习者提供了丰富的学习资源。其中,源码学习成为了编程爱好者和专业人士不可或缺的一部分。本文将探讨在线学习中的源码,分析其重要性,并分享一些有效的源码学习策略。

一、源码在在线学习中的重要性

1.深入理解编程原理

通过阅读源码,学习者可以深入了解编程语言、框架和工具的内部实现原理。这有助于提高编程能力,为以后的项目开发打下坚实基础。

2.提高代码质量

学习优秀项目的源码,可以帮助学习者学习到规范的编程习惯、代码结构和设计模式。在实际编程过程中,借鉴这些经验,可以有效提高代码质量。

3.拓展视野,拓宽思路

阅读不同领域的源码,可以让学习者了解到不同编程风格和技术选型。这有助于拓宽视野,激发创新思维。

4.解决实际问题

在遇到编程难题时,查阅相关项目的源码,可以帮助学习者找到解决方案。此外,源码中的注释和文档也可以为学习者提供有益的参考。

二、在线学习源码的策略

1.选择合适的在线学习平台

目前,许多在线学习平台都提供了丰富的源码资源。选择一个适合自己的平台,可以更方便地获取所需源码。以下是一些热门的在线学习平台:

(1)GitHub:全球最大的开源代码托管平台,拥有大量高质量的开源项目。

(2)码云:国内优秀的开源代码托管平台,提供丰富的中文开源项目。

(3)CSDN:国内最大的IT社区和服务平台,拥有大量技术博客、问答和源码分享。

2.制定学习计划

在阅读源码之前,先了解项目的背景、功能和架构。制定一个合理的学习计划,有助于提高学习效率。

3.逐步深入

从项目的核心模块开始,逐步了解各个模块之间的关系和实现方式。对于复杂的项目,可以先了解整体架构,再逐步深入。

4.注重实践

阅读源码的过程中,要结合实际编程项目进行实践。通过动手实践,加深对源码的理解,提高编程能力。

5.查阅资料,拓展知识面

在阅读源码的过程中,遇到不懂的技术点,要及时查阅相关资料。同时,关注业界动态,了解新技术、新框架,拓宽知识面。

6.加入社区,交流学习

加入相关技术社区,与其他学习者交流学习心得。在交流过程中,可以了解到更多优秀的源码,提高自己的编程水平。

三、总结

在线学习中的源码学习是提高编程能力的重要途径。通过阅读优秀项目的源码,学习者可以深入了解编程原理,提高代码质量,拓展视野,解决实际问题。在今后的学习过程中,我们要善于利用在线学习平台,制定合理的学习计划,注重实践,拓展知识面,不断丰富自己的编程技能。